AI and 3D Imaging: The Game Changers
Mtrisen, a leader in agricultural tech innovations, has spearheaded the development of a breakthrough solution that harnesses the power of AI and 3D image processing. By automatically measuring a mother pig’s body shape - a critical isometric angle - in a non-contact manner, farm operators can now ensure that nutrition is perfectly tailored to each animal’s needs. This, in turn, addresses issues tied to obesity and undernourishment in pregnant sows.
Comprehensive Body Management
Proper body management is crucial, as an imbalance can lead to increased production costs and health issues such as poor mammary gland development or stillbirths. By capturing accurate data, Mtrisen’s AI solution successfully navigates these concerns, securing an impressive 98.7% accuracy rate through advanced algorithms and extensive video and behavioral data.
Transforming Farm Operations
The real-world implications of this technology are revolutionary. According to 매일경제, demonstrations across over 30 farms revealed that piglet production per sow per year (PSY) increased by an average of 1.5 to 2.0, significantly boosting feed efficiency and labor savings. This technological shift has, on average, increased farm profits by 230 million won per farm, underscoring the financial viability of adopting AI-driven systems.
